The 18th match of the Big Bash League 2020 will feature the bottom dwellers Melbourne Renegades and table toppers Sydney Sixers at the Carrara Oval in Queensland. The second match of the Tuesday doubleheader is set to take place between Sydney Thunder and Melbourne Stars.

Renegades find themselves at the bottom phase of the table with just 1 win from the 4 games played so far and find themselves only better than Perth Scorchers who are languishing at the bottom with 2 points from 3 games. Sixers on the other side find themselves at the top of things after managing to win a thriller of a match against the Melbourne Stars, Sixers with the help of their skipper Daniel Hughes fantastic 96 managed to chase down 194.

The teams have already met once this season and Renegades would want to forget that encounter as they were reduced to 60, the lowest score in this season of BBL. Renegades after winning the toss elected to bowl first and the misery started from ball one. Sixers raced on to register a mammoth 205 courtesy of a brilliant 95 by Josh Philippe. Renegades in reply were clueless as they kept losing wickets in a cluster and ended up being all out for 60.

Weather Report

The conditions are ideal for cricket as clear skies are expected throughout the course of the game. The temperature is expected to hover in the 30-25 degree range and the humidity at the peak is likely to touch the 61 percent mark.

Pitch

The only game has been played at the Carrara Oval so far and for the reason, that pitch is still fresh and ideal for the batsmen to get going. As we saw in the match between Sixers and Stars, the match had an aggregate of close to 400 runs and the same can be expected for this encounter. The team winning the toss should be looking to chase, anything less than 170 by the team batting first is likely to be chased down with ease.

Team News

Renegades have been struggling to show any considerable performances and their batting despite having the big names like Aaron Finch and Shaun Marsh have failed miserably, being dismissed for double digits on two occasions this season, Finch and Co. will have to step it up.

Zak Evans has been leaking runs in his last few games and for that reason, Jack Prestwidge is likely to replace him in the playing Xl.

Sixers have been unstoppable so far and have in addition to winning matches they have been doing a great job in keeping the spectators entertained. There is no reason to fiddle with the playing Xl as they have been doing well and seem well balanced in all the departments.
